Instant Pot Sausage Stew with Beans

The old but gold Sausage Stew with beans is a filling recipe with a rustic flavor. This instant pot recipe is the perfect example when taste and flavor are more important than presentation.

Equipment

  • instant pot

Ingredients

  • 6 medium sausages
  • 1 can tomatoes
  • 2 cans beans
  • 1/2 bulb fennel
  • 1 medium onion
  • 1 medium bell pepper optional
  • 3 cloves garlic
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 1/2 tsp ground pepper
  • 1 tsp paprika
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 handful coriander

Instructions

  • Set the "saute" regime on the instant pot, pour in one tablespoon of olive oil and when the preheating is done, add in the sausages
  • Use kitchen tongs to turn the sides of the sausages from time to time. Fry them for 10 minutes, then set them aside on a different plate
  • In the meantime, peel and chop the veggies
  • Change the program to "stew" and set the "low heat" for 20 minutes. Let the veggies saute for about 10 minutes, remember to stir occasionally
  • Then, pour in the canned tomatoes and stir again. Season with spices such as granulated garlic, paprika, and salt
  • Add the chopped fresh coriander and sautee everything for additional 5 minutes
  • Add in the fried sausages and the canned beans
  • Cook for another 5 minutes
  • Turn off the instant pot and serve with pleasure
